> Also, please be careful when adding code to any of the backend that uses 
> backticks as aposed to fork&exec/perl system().  backticks are evil unless 
> your in *your* shell.
> 
> There's mkdir's and other stuff in it now which uses backticks which
> will (and did yesterday) break taint mode.  Whoever commited
> backtick-using-code, please fix this, and use perl system(...) == 0
> or die(), instead..

It's me. The change fixes the missing "-p" option in mkdir and was
taken from Savane. I'll remember to change it back after the merge.
